Mecseknádasd (Croatian: Nadoš, Nadaš; German: Nadasch) is a town in Baranya county, Hungary.
Sightseeings
In the cemetery hill there is an old, Árpád-age Romanesque church, which was originally the parish church of the village.
In front of the Bishop's Palace is a statue of Franz Liszt.
Moreover, the village cultivates the remembrance of Saint Margaret of Scotland. She was the daughter of the English prince Edward the Exile, son of Edmund Ironside. She was born at Castle Réka, Mecseknádasd.
